Punjab Police Busts ISI-Backed Terror Modules, Arrests Nine

Punjab Police announced the dismantling of two terror modules backed by Pakistan's ISI, arresting nine individuals, including four minors. Preliminary investigations suggest the accused were recruited by foreign-based ISI handlers to conduct terror activities. Recovered items include pistols, cartridges, petrol bombs, and CCTV equipment. The modules were allegedly involved in conducting reconnaissance, including placing CCTV cameras on railway tracks to send footage to Pakistan. Some reports indicate threats were made against Punjab's Chief Minister and Governor, and plans to bomb courts and government buildings.
